The following post shows the range of Euromold Connectors which are suitable for and manufacturer approved for use with Ormazabal medium/high voltage equipment bushings according to IEC 50181. BS EN 50181:2010 is the industry standard for plug-in type bushings above 1kV up to 52kV and from 250A to 2,50kA for MV-HV switchgear and transformers.
Euromold Connectors & Acessories

EN 50181 IEC Bushing Types
Ormazabal recommends the use of Euromold connectors for the termination of MV-HV cables as they have been tested in the Ormazabal CGMCOSMOS system cubicles.
CGMCOSMOS is part of the Ormazabal Medium Voltage Switchgear Secondary Distribution range – a fully gas-insulated modular and compact (RMU) system up to 24kV.
3 different types of EN 50181 (IEC) bushing types that are manufactured in epoxy resin and conform to the dielectric and partial tests.
• Plug-in Bushing up to 250 A
• Plug-in Bushing up to 400 A
• Screw-in Bushing up to 630 A
MV-HV bushings are located in the cable compartment or can also be placed on the side of the cubicles for direct supply to the main busbar via plug-in or screw-in connectors rated current greater than 400A or short-circuit current equal to or higher than 16kA.
250A plug-in cable connectors (straight or elbow type for rear exit of cable) in outputs to transformer (cable compartment) for fuse protection functions and shielded connectors for circuit-breaker protection functions.
